Commissioned in 1972, this facility utilizes dam-based technology to effectively convert the kinetic energy of flowing water into electrical energy. As part of the broader French commitment to renewable energy, La Coche Power Station is integral to the national energy mix, providing a sustainable source of electricity that aligns with France&#8217;s goals for reducing carbon emissions and enhancing energy security.
